Machinery moving equipment is the one category on a jobsite where the published number and the usable number diverge most often — and where the gap between them is measured in tons suspended over someone's feet. A web sling has three different capacities depending on how you rig it. A four-piece skate set has one capacity that may be per skate or for the set, and two listings from the same brand disagree about which. A pair of fork extensions changes what your forklift is rated to carry, and OSHA requires the capacity plate to be changed to match.
This guide ranks twelve items from the lifting and positioning, machine skate and forklift attachment collections, organised by the four stages of the job, with every capacity read off the manufacturer's own listing and mapped to 29 CFR 1910.184 and 1910.178. Stage 1 — lift it: hydraulic toe jacks
A machine bolted flat to a floor has nowhere for a bottle jack to go. A toe jack has a claw that slides into a fraction of an inch of clearance and lifts from the toe, with a second pad on top for conventional lifting once you have room. Every toe jack publishes two very different numbers, and the toe rating is always the lower one.

Stage 2 — sling it: synthetic web slings
A web sling has three capacities, not one, and the difference between them is the difference between a lift and an incident. 29 CFR 1910.184(i)(1) requires that "each sling shall be marked or coded to show the rated capacities for each type of hitch and type of synthetic web material" — so all three numbers should be on the tag before the sling ever touches a load.

Stage 3 — hold and pull it: chain hoists and lever hoists
A hand chain hoist lifts vertically from an overhead anchor; a lever hoist (a come-along) pulls in any direction and is the tool for dragging a machine into position or taking up slack on a sling. Both are rated in tons and both live or die on the brake.

Per skate or per set? The question that changes a rating fourfold
This is the single most dangerous ambiguity in the machine-skate category, and two listings from the same brand illustrate it perfectly.
The VEVOR 4PCS set says: "8-Ton Total Capacity: This 4-pack of heavy-duty machinery skate dollies effortlessly handles loads up to 17,637 lbs." That is explicit — 17,637 lb is the whole set, about 4,400 lb per corner.
The VEVOR 4-Piece 12T set says: "Massive 12-Ton Load Capacity: … up to 26,455 lbs per dolly." Read literally, that is a set that carries 105,820 lb — 48 tonnes — which would be an extraordinary claim for four low-profile skates, and it sits inconsistently beside the same manufacturer's own convention on the 8-ton set, where the headline tonnage is the total.
Treat the headline tonnage as the set rating unless the manufacturer confirms otherwise in writing, and size the move on the worst-loaded corner rather than on any total. Machine weight is almost never distributed evenly across four points — a lathe carries most of its mass at the headstock — so even a correct set rating is not four equal shares. If you need certainty, buy single skates with an unambiguous per-unit rating, like the 8,800 lb Amarite, and count them yourself.
The three numbers on a sling, and why basket is exactly double
Every web sling in this guide publishes a basket rating exactly twice its vertical rating, and a choker rating around 80% of vertical. That is not a coincidence and it is not a safety margin you can borrow against — it is geometry. In a vertical hitch one leg of webbing carries the load. In a basket hitch the sling passes under the load with both ends on the hook, so two legs share it. In a choker the sling is pulled around itself, and the bend at the choke point reduces what the webbing can carry.

What OSHA 1910.184 requires of a sling
The sling standard is unusually concrete, and most of it is a purchasing and daily-use checklist rather than paperwork.
The tag is the rating. 1910.184(i)(1): "Each sling shall be marked or coded to show the rated capacities for each type of hitch and type of synthetic web material." 1910.184(c)(13) requires employers not to load a sling beyond "its recommended safe working load as prescribed by the sling manufacturer on the identification markings permanently affixed to the sling", and 1910.184(c)(14) is blunt: "Employers must not use slings without affixed and legible identification markings." A sling whose tag has worn illegible is out of service, not merely untidy.
Inspect every day, before use. 1910.184(d): "Each day before being used, the sling and all fastenings and attachments shall be inspected for damage or defects by a competent person designated by the employer … Damaged or defective slings shall be immediately removed from service."
The operating rules. Slings shall not be loaded beyond rated capacity (c)(4); shall not be shortened with knots or bolts (c)(2); legs shall not be kinked (c)(3); loads in a basket hitch shall be balanced to prevent slippage (c)(5); slings shall be padded or protected from sharp edges (c)(7); employees shall be kept clear of loads about to be lifted and of suspended loads (c)(9); hands or fingers shall not be placed between the sling and its load while the sling is being tightened (c)(10); shock loading is prohibited (c)(11); and a sling shall not be pulled from under a load resting on it (c)(12).
Material and temperature limits. 1910.184(i)(6) bars nylon web slings "where fumes, vapors, sprays, mists or liquids of acids or phenolics are present", and bars polyester and polypropylene "where fumes, vapors, sprays, mists or liquids of caustics are present". 1910.184(i)(7) caps polyester and nylon at 180 °F and polypropylene at 200 °F. And repairs are not a shop job: 1910.184(i)(8) allows repair only by a sling manufacturer or equivalent entity, with proof testing to twice the rated capacity before the sling returns to service.
Fork extensions are a front-end attachment, not an accessory
Fitting extensions to a forklift is the step in this guide most often treated as shopping when it is actually a modification. Three paragraphs of 29 CFR 1910.178 apply directly.
1910.178(a)(4): "Modifications and additions which affect capacity and safe operation shall not be performed by the customer or user without manufacturers prior written approval. Capacity, operation, and maintenance instruction plates, tags, or decals shall be changed accordingly." Extensions move the load centre forward, which changes capacity — so this is written approval plus an updated capacity plate, not a bolt-on.
1910.178(a)(5): "If the truck is equipped with front-end attachments other than factory installed attachments, the user shall request that the truck be marked to identify the attachments and show the approximate weight of the truck and attachment combination at maximum elevation with load laterally centered."
1910.178(o)(4) is the operating rule people miss entirely: "Trucks equipped with attachments shall be operated as partially loaded trucks when not handling a load." The extensions themselves count as load. Add 1910.178(o)(2) — only loads within the rated capacity of the truck — and the picture is complete: buy the extensions, get the approval, re-plate the truck, and treat it as carrying something even when the forks are empty. Machinery moving: frequently asked questions
What equipment do you need to move a heavy machine?
Four things, in order: a toe jack to break it off the floor, slings and a hoist to take the weight or steady it, machine skates to carry it, and a lever hoist to pull it into position. A pallet jack does not work on a bare machine because there is nothing for the forks to enter — that is what skates replace. See best pallet jacks only if the machine is already on a pallet or skid.
Why does a sling have three different capacities?
Because the hitch changes how many legs of webbing carry the load and how the webbing is bent. Vertical is one leg; basket passes the sling under the load with both ends up, so two legs share it and the rating is double; choker pulls the sling around itself and the bend at the choke reduces capacity to roughly 80% of vertical. 29 CFR 1910.184(i)(1) requires all of them to be marked on the sling.
Is a basket hitch always exactly twice the vertical rating?
On every sling in this guide, yes — Keeper 3,100/6,200, DD Sling 6,400/12,800, Trekassy 6,200/12,400, Kodiak 3,100/6,200. But that doubling assumes the legs hang vertically. As the legs angle outward the tension in each rises, and at wide angles a basket can be worth far less than double. 1910.184(c)(5) also requires basket loads to be balanced to prevent slippage. Read the sling's tag and mind the angle.
Can you use a sling that has lost its tag?
No. 29 CFR 1910.184(c)(14) states that employers "must not use slings without affixed and legible identification markings", and (c)(13) ties the safe working load to the markings permanently affixed to the sling. A sling with an unreadable tag has no defensible rating, whatever the invoice said. The DD Sling ships a serial-numbered tag for exactly this reason.
Nylon or polyester slings — which should you buy?
The environment decides, and the two materials cover each other's exclusions. 1910.184(i)(6) bars nylon where fumes, vapours, sprays, mists or liquids of acids or phenolics are present, and bars polyester and polypropylene where caustics are present. Beyond that, polyester stretches less (under 5% on the Kodiak listing) and resists UV; nylon is more elastic and absorbs shock slightly better. Both are capped at 180 °F by 1910.184(i)(7).
How often must lifting slings be inspected?
Every day before use. 1910.184(d) requires that "each day before being used, the sling and all fastenings and attachments shall be inspected for damage or defects by a competent person designated by the employer", with additional inspections during use where service conditions warrant, and immediate removal from service of anything damaged or defective.
Can you repair a damaged web sling?
Not in-house. 1910.184(i)(8) allows repair only by a sling manufacturer or an equivalent entity, and every repaired sling must be proof tested by that entity to twice its rated capacity before returning to service. In practice a damaged web sling is a replacement, not a repair.
Is a 4-piece machine skate set rated per skate or for the set?
Check the listing wording and assume the set unless it says otherwise in writing. The VEVOR 4PCS states 17,637 lb as an explicit 8-ton total. The VEVOR 12T says 26,455 lb "per dolly", which read literally would make the set 48 tonnes and is inconsistent with the same brand's other listing. Size the move on the worst-loaded corner, not on any total.
How many machine skates do you need?
Enough that the heaviest single support point stays under one skate's rating, which is usually four at the corners for a square machine or three in a triangle for stability on uneven floors. Machine weight is rarely even — a lathe carries most of its mass at the headstock — so divide by the real distribution, not by four. Single high-capacity skates like the 8,800 lb Amarite make that arithmetic easier.
What is a toe jack and when do you need one?
A toe jack has a claw that slides into a fraction of an inch of clearance under a machine base and lifts from the toe, with a second pad on top for conventional lifting. You need one whenever a machine sits flat on the floor with no lifting points and no room for a bottle jack — which is most machines. Every toe jack publishes two ratings and the toe figure is always the lower one; buy on that.
Chain hoist or lever hoist — what is the difference?
A hand chain hoist lifts vertically from an overhead anchor and is operated by pulling a loop of hand chain. A lever hoist, or come-along, is worked by a ratcheting handle and pulls in any direction, which makes it the tool for dragging a machine into alignment once it is on skates. Most machinery moves need both.
Do fork extensions reduce a forklift's capacity?
Yes, because they move the load centre forward and forklift capacity is quoted at a specific load centre. That is why 29 CFR 1910.178(a)(4) requires the manufacturer's prior written approval for modifications and additions affecting capacity, and requires the capacity plates to be changed accordingly. 1910.178(a)(5) additionally requires the truck to be marked to identify the attachment and show the weight of the truck-and-attachment combination.
Do you have to do anything differently when driving with fork extensions fitted but no load?
Yes, and it is the rule most often missed. 29 CFR 1910.178(o)(4): "Trucks equipped with attachments shall be operated as partially loaded trucks when not handling a load." The extensions are themselves weight out in front of the front axle, so travel, braking and turning should be treated as if the truck is carrying something even with empty forks.
What is shock loading and why does it matter so much?
Shock loading is applying load suddenly — snatching slack out of a sling, dropping a load onto it, or jerking a lever hoist. The instantaneous force can be many times the static weight, which is why 1910.184(c)(11) prohibits it outright rather than derating for it. Take up slack slowly until the sling is just tight, then check the rigging before lifting.

When should a machine skate or hoist be taken out of service?
A skate: when a roller is flat-spotted, seized or shedding polyurethane, when the swivel cap will not rotate, or when the frame is visibly deformed. A hoist: when a chain link is stretched, gouged or twisted, when the brake will not hold a test load, when a hook is opened out or its latch is missing, or when the load chain is corroded. In every case the fault is structural, not serviceable — replace it.
